Embodiment 1
[0049] Add 451.4mL of 7.5% HCl aqueous solution, 101.6g of N,N'-diacetyl-1,8-p-menthanediamine (400mmol ), start stirring, and heat to reflux for 8h. After the reaction, the reaction solution was cooled and allowed to stand, and the reaction solution was separated into layers. The yellow oily liquid in the upper layer was evaporated in vacuo to obtain 43 g (220.5 mmol) of a viscous yellow oily intermediate product, with a yield of 55.1%.
Embodiment 2
[0051] Add 398mL of 10% HCl aqueous solution and 101.6g (400mmol) of N,N'-diacetyl-1,8-p-menthanediamine into a 1L four-neck flask equipped with a thermometer, condenser and mechanical stirrer , started stirring, and heated to reflux for 8h. After the reaction, the reaction solution was cooled and allowed to stand, and the reaction solution was separated into layers. The yellow oily liquid in the upper layer was evaporated in vacuo to obtain 43.9 g (225.2 mmol) of a viscous yellow oily intermediate product, with a yield of 56.3%.
Embodiment 3
[0053] Add concentration of 20% H 2 SO 4 460 mL of aqueous solution, 101.6 g (400 mmol) of N,N'-diacetyl-1,8-p-mentanediamine, started stirring, and heated to reflux for 10 h. After the reaction, the reaction solution was cooled and allowed to stand, and the reaction solution was separated into layers. The yellow oily liquid in the upper layer was evaporated in vacuo to obtain 41.4 g (212.3 mmol) of a viscous yellow oily intermediate product, with a yield of 53.1%.
